Hi All! I just got back from a long visit to DLR! It was a lot of fun, but I didn't get nearly as many holiday photos as I had expected/hoped!

Viva Navidad - the street show is cute and worth seeing (but I probably wouldn't make a special trip to Paradise Pier just to see it; I was in the area (at Ariel's) so I headed over there). It's not very long, but it's very lively and festive. There are dancers and a mariachi band. The Three Caballeros, Mickey, and Minnie are in the dance party. It happens in the street area in front of Boardwalk Pizza & Pasta and Paradise Garden Grill.

Winter Dreams (WOC) - lots of Frozen! If you like Frozen, then this show is for you...if you don't like Frozen (and especially Olaf), then it might not be the show for you. It was just, but you have to commit a lot of time if you want a good view. I'd allow at least 90 minutes. The show itself is very colorful and has lots of holiday movie clips and music.

Mad T Party - the set has holiday decor added (snow flakes, lots of light colored lanterns, candy cane wraps, etc.). They sang "All I Want for Christmas" and a few other holiday songs at the end of the set. I like Mad T Party and will be sad to see it end later this month.

GCH Gingerbread House - The house was going up when I stopped by on Friday night. It was pretty neat to look at and to watch the chefs create it. I spoke with one of the CM working on it and he was saying some of the chefs on this team (including him) were also on the team that makes the HMH gingerbread house!

That's a tough question; last week I saw folks sitting for the parade at least 90 minutes before hand. I was actually pretty surprised; on both Tuesday and Wednesday, pretty much all of the MS curb spots had been taken an hour before the parade was slated to start. I think you might be able to find somewhere to stand and watch the parade closer to the start time, but if you want to sit or have a front row spot to watch the parade, it looked like you had to get there at least an hour before hand.

(Side note, I didn't know the FP for Anna & Elsa are NON-transferrable! At the beginning of the line they scan your FP AND park ticket to make sure they were really issued to you. I had no idea and had planned to hand off the tickets to someone else if we hadn't been able to do it).
I wanted to add to this...you have to enter the A&E line with your entire party. Unlike normal FP's, the A&E Return Ticket is assigned to a specific person and that individual must use it to enter the line. I went with a large group and most of us were ready to enter the line. The CM collected our Return Ticket and scanned our tickets with the handheld device. Little photos of everyone in the group appeared (the photo was grayed out when the ticket was scanned). Two from our party was not there yet and CM asked if they were coming because they would either have to void their Return Ticket or the group would need to wait for them to arrive. We opted to void their Return Tickets. So, just something to keep in mind; your entire party (or at least everyone that wants to meet A&E) needs to be present when you arrive at the line.

Oh also, make sure you include any children under three in your count when you get the Return Tickets. They'll mark that the ticket is for an under three year old, but you still need it when you return to the A&E line.
